深入解析《龙OL》源码:揭秘经典网游的奥秘
随着互联网技术的飞速发展,网络游戏成为了人们休闲娱乐的重要方式。其中,《龙OL》作为一款深受玩家喜爱的经典网游,其源码的解析对于游戏开发者来说具有重要的参考价值。本文将深入解析《龙OL》源码,带你领略这款经典网游的魅力所在。
一、《龙OL》源码简介
《龙OL》是一款由国内知名游戏公司开发的大型多人在线角色扮演游戏(MMORPG)。自2004年上线以来,凭借其丰富的游戏内容、精美的画面和完善的社交系统,吸引了大量玩家。在游戏开发领域,其源码一直备受关注,成为众多开发者学习的对象。
二、源码解析的意义
1.学习游戏开发技术
通过解析《龙OL》源码,我们可以了解到游戏开发中的关键技术,如服务器架构、客户端渲染、网络通信等。这对于有志于从事游戏开发的人员来说,具有很高的参考价值。
2.模仿与创新
通过研究《龙OL》源码,我们可以学习到其他优秀游戏的开发经验,为我国游戏产业提供借鉴。同时,在借鉴的基础上,我们还可以进行创新,打造出具有中国特色的优质游戏。
3.提高游戏性能
通过对《龙OL》源码的分析,我们可以发现游戏中的性能瓶颈,从而进行优化。这有助于提高游戏运行速度,提升玩家体验。
三、《龙OL》源码解析要点
1.服务器架构
《龙OL》采用分布式服务器架构,将游戏服务器分为多个模块,如角色管理、地图管理、任务系统等。这种架构具有高可用性、高性能的特点。
2.客户端渲染
《龙OL》采用DirectX技术进行客户端渲染,画面精美,运行流畅。源码中涉及到角色模型、场景渲染、光影效果等关键技术。
3.网络通信
《龙OL》采用TCP/IP协议进行网络通信,保证了游戏数据的稳定传输。源码中包含了客户端与服务器之间的通信协议,如角色登录、地图移动、物品交易等。
4.游戏系统
《龙OL》拥有完善的游戏系统,包括角色成长、技能树、装备系统、任务系统等。源码中涉及到这些系统的设计思路和实现方法。
四、总结
通过对《龙OL》源码的解析,我们不仅可以学习到游戏开发中的关键技术,还可以为我国游戏产业提供借鉴。在今后的游戏开发过程中,我们可以借鉴《龙OL》的成功经验,结合自身特点,打造出更多优秀的游戏作品。同时,我们也要关注游戏产业的创新发展,为玩家带来更加丰富的游戏体验。
总之,《龙OL》源码的解析对于游戏开发者来说具有重要的意义。希望本文的介绍能够为读者提供一定的帮助,共同推动我国游戏产业的发展。